The Potomac Subregion is primarily characterized by low-density residential development, green space, and significant natural and environmental resources. Concrete improvements should therefore be considered in relation to existing landscaping, established grades, long vehicle approaches, drainage patterns, and the balance between paved and unpaved portions of the site.
A vehicle approach may connect the street, entrance apron, driveway, parking section, garage, and pedestrian route. A formal entry may combine masonry, walkways, steps, landings, landscaping, and the front doorway. Behind the home, a patio or terrace may sit among the building, yard, garden features, pool area, or accessory structures.
Those relationships matter even when the proposed work is limited. A surface that is too small may not support the intended activity, while one that is unnecessarily large may interfere with circulation, landscaping, or the visual balance of the property. Reviewing the full setting helps determine what the concrete must accomplish, which features should remain, and where transitions require closer planning.

Outdoor concrete may support seating, dining, entertaining, recreation, or movement between the home and surrounding landscape. Dimensions should reflect furniture placement, doorways, walking routes, nearby structures, and the number of people expected to use the space.
Stamped patterns, borders, color treatments, or other decorative options may be considered when appearance is part of the project goal. The selected finish should also provide suitable traction, remain practical to maintain, and fit the way the surface will be used.
An entrance usually functions as a sequence rather than one independent surface. The driveway edge, walkway, steps, landing, stoop, porch, and doorway all influence how the approach works and how it relates to the home.
Planning should account for route width, elevation changes, transition points, adjoining masonry, and the sections intended to remain. A focused improvement may update one part of the entrance without requiring every nearby feature to be rebuilt.
Vehicle-related work may include complete driveways, selected replacement sections, additional width, parking pads, and connections to garages or roadway surfaces. The layout should reflect vehicle dimensions, turning movement, parking position, pedestrian crossings, and the way drivers enter and leave the property.
Replacing an entire driveway is different from adding parking capacity or rebuilding one failed portion. Identifying the actual vehicle-use need helps establish appropriate boundaries.
Localized repair, resurfacing, selected-section replacement, and complete replacement address different levels of deterioration. The condition and stability of the concrete determine which approaches remain realistic.
A surface treatment cannot correct significant movement or deeper support failure, but one damaged section does not automatically justify removing an entire connected area.
General slabs may support storage buildings, work areas, recreation, or other property uses. Equipment, generator, and utility pads require closer attention to dimensions, clearances, service access, and support requirements.
Commercial and managed-property work may include entrances, pedestrian surfaces, curbs, loading sections, dumpster pads, service zones, and other operational flatwork. Each surface should be planned around the people, vehicles, equipment, and activities it serves.

We first identify the activity the completed surface must accommodate. A formal entrance, daily vehicle route, entertaining patio, equipment pad, and commercial service section each create different requirements for size, layout, capacity, and finish.
The goal is not necessarily to use the maximum available space. Dimensions should support the intended activity while remaining proportionate to the surrounding setting.
New concrete may need to meet masonry, asphalt, older slabs, steps, curbs, garage floors, walls, or building thresholds. These meeting points help establish edges, finished elevations, and transition details.
Reviewing them early clarifies which existing sections can remain and reduces the need for last-minute adjustments after preparation has begun.
Long driveways, gates, landscaping, structures, occupied entrances, and surfaces requiring protection may influence demolition, delivery, formwork, placement, and cleanup. On a larger property, reaching the work zone may require as much planning as the completed slab.
Understanding the access route early helps identify equipment needs, staging locations, protection measures, and a workable construction sequence.
The completed concrete must fit the elevations of the property and the surfaces around it. Existing grades, structures, landscape edges, drainage routes, and adjoining pavement may all influence how the surface is positioned.
The layout should not create abrupt connections or unintentionally redirect water toward buildings, entrances, planting areas, or other exterior improvements.
Preparation, slab dimensions, reinforcement, joint placement, edges, curing, and drainage all influence performance. The construction details should reflect what the concrete must support and how it will be used rather than relying on one specification for every project.

A project may involve new installation, expansion, localized repair, resurfacing, selected-section replacement, or complete replacement.
New installation creates a surface where none currently exists. Expansion adds driveway width, parking, patio space, walking area, or another form of usable capacity. Localized repair addresses a contained concern, while resurfacing renews concrete that remains stable enough to support a bonded treatment. Selected replacement removes and rebuilds defined failed sections, and complete replacement may be appropriate when the original surface can no longer provide the intended result.
These methods are not interchangeable. A limited treatment should not be presented as the solution to broader failure, but complete reconstruction should not be recommended without a practical reason. The appropriate direction should reflect the existing condition, desired use, surrounding improvements, and established project boundaries.

Pricing depends on more than the dimensions of the completed surface. Long access routes, gates, limited staging locations, protection of landscaping or masonry, demolition, disposal, material handling, grade changes, base preparation, slab thickness, reinforcement, drainage, and decorative finishes can all affect the estimate. A patio, terrace, or pool-adjacent section located far from the street may require different equipment and coordination than a similarly sized surface beside an open driveway.
